Does anyone know if last years frozen dandelions would still be Ok to make wine with. Due to circumstances, was not able to make. Its almost time for fresh ones, but I hate to throw out last years.

Tony
 
If they have stayed frozen the whole time I'd be willing to give them a try. I usually have to pick on multiple days and freeze batches of picked and cleaned pedals during the season. I havent had any bad experience from it but can also say they have been used up in about 3 months after picking.
 
Actually I have done that.

I have frozen dandelions and forgot about them for a year.
When cleaning out the freezer found them and used them.
Turned out well.
